The Seneca Falls Hydroelectric Project, located in Seneca County, New York, is a 5.1 MW conventional hydroelectric facility. It began operating in 1917 and is owned and operated by C-S Canal Hydro, LLC. The plant utilizes water (WAT) as its primary fuel source and consists of three generators. It operates within the New York Independent System Operator (NYISO) balancing authority and the Northeast Power Coordinating Council (NPCC) NERC region.
In the most recent year of reported data, the Seneca Falls Hydroelectric Project generated 9,842 MWh of electricity, achieving a capacity factor of 22.1%. The plant ranks as the 74th largest hydroelectric facility in New York State out of 165, and nationally it ranks 866th out of 1464 hydroelectric plants.
